Keywords become document memory when they are connected to source evidence, accepted interpretations, and reusable answers rather than stored as isolated tags.
Keywords Are the First Signal
Keywords help identify what a document is about. They make it easier to search, group, and summarize files.
But a keyword alone does not preserve what the team learned from the document.
Memory Needs Evidence
For a keyword to become useful memory, it should connect to source passages and the answer the team accepted.
This helps future users verify the context instead of trusting a loose tag.
Corrections Make Memory Smarter
If an AI answer misunderstands a keyword or concept, a human correction should be saved.
That correction can override stale or generic interpretations later.
